Cambria Hotel Rapid City Near Mount Rushmore
44.10035, -103.15956The 3-star Cambria Hotel Rapid City Near Mount Rushmore includes modern rooms about 6 miles from WaTiki Indoor Waterpark Resort. This upscale hotel, located approximately a 15-minute drive from Rushmore Plaza Civic Center Arena, features a convenience store and a restaurant.
Location
The hotel offers a convenient location a 21-minute drive from Rapid City Regional airport. You'll find Watiki Indoor Waterpark 2.4 miles from the property. This Rapid City hotel is also within close proximity of Dinosaur State Park.
Rooms
There are 111 rooms at Cambria Hotel Rapid City Near Mount Rushmore, each of them has an iron with ironing board and an air conditioner, as well as entertainment amenities such as a TV with satellite channels. Fitted with coffee/tea making machines, the rooms also come with a couch set and a writing desk.
Eat & Drink
Guests can enjoy the lounge bar on premises. You can dine at Reflect Bistro and Bar, just near this Rapid City accommodation.
Leisure & Business
A fitness area and a swimming pool are available at the non-smoking Cambria Hotel Rapid City Near Mount Rushmore. There are a conference room and 3 meeting rooms with a work desk and a fax machine available on site.
